Wide scale antimicrobial usage in animal farming accelerates antimicrobial-resistant (AMR) bacteria which is spread onto the human population that consume the products and the environment into which livestock farming wastes are released. Agricultural authorities need to regulate the use of antibiotics in farming, in general, so that the AMR bacteria risk is reduced.
